Liaison arrived as a high-stakes bridge between British and French television traditions, marking a significant moment in the globalization of streaming content. Starring Eva Green and Vincent Cassel, the series explored the intersection of personal history and national security. Its legacy lies in its sophisticated handling of post-Brexit geopolitical tensions and the fragility of modern digital infrastructure. While it remained a limited engagement, the show proved that prestige espionage could thrive outside the standard Hollywood mold. By blending romantic tension with cold cyber-warfare, it challenged viewers to consider how private secrets influence public policy. As the landscape of international thrillers continues to evolve, this production remains a polished example of cross-border storytelling. Production Note - Limited Series

Production Type: Limited Series

Liaison is a standalone Limited Series designed as a completed, finite historical narrative. This high-stakes espionage thriller was conceived as a multi-layered story exploring the intersection of political intrigue, cyber-warfare, and personal history between its two lead protagonists. The production was structured to resolve its central conspiracy within a single season, providing a definitive end to the immediate threats posed to the national security of the United Kingdom and France.

The series represents a significant international collaboration, being the first French and English language original production for its streaming platform. By utilizing a fixed six-episode format, the creators focused on a tight, cinematic pacing that allowed for a complete character arc for the main operatives. This intentional design ensured that the narrative reached a conclusive resolution, maintaining the integrity of its specific political and romantic stakes without the requirement for ongoing seasonal expansion.

Frequently Asked Questions

Liaison was developed as a standalone limited series, so there are no plans for a second season. The storyline concludes definitively within its six episodes and would only continue if it were transitioned into an anthology format.

The series is not based on a book or a true story but is an original work created and written by Virginie Brac. While it reflects modern concerns regarding cybersecurity and international relations, the characters and specific plot points are entirely fictional.

Production for Liaison took place primarily in London and various locations across France to reflect the cross-border nature of the plot. The filming locations were chosen to provide an authentic backdrop for the high-stakes political espionage depicted in the show.

The complete series consists of six episodes. Each installment contributes to a single, cohesive narrative arc that concludes the main mystery by the series finale.

Liaison is a bilingual production that features dialogue in both English and French. This dual-language approach is central to the show's identity as it follows the cooperation and tension between British and French intelligence agencies.

The series features Vincent Cassel and Eva Green in the leading roles as Gabriel Delage and Alison Rowdy. Their performances drive the emotional and political tension as their characters navigate a shared past and a dangerous present.

The show follows two agents who must work together to stop devastating cyberattacks threatening the United Kingdom. As they investigate the threats, they are forced to confront the secrets of their past relationship and the political corruption surrounding them.
